🔹 WiFi 6 Technology: Faster, Smarter, More Reliable

Unlike traditional routers, the Deco X20 uses WiFi 6 (802.11ax) for:

  • OFDMA & MU-MIMO – Handles multiple devices efficiently.
  • Higher Speeds (AX1800) – Up to 1.8 Gbps (600 Mbps on 2.4GHz + 1,201 Mbps on 5GHz).
  • Better Battery Life for Smart Devices – Thanks to Target Wake Time (TWT).

🔹 Seamless Mesh Coverage (Up to 5,800 Sq. Ft.)

  • 3-Pack System – Blankets large homes with consistent WiFi.
  • Auto-Roaming – Devices switch between nodes without drops.
  • Wired Ethernet Backhaul Support – For lag-free connections (6 ports total).

❓ FAQs (Voice-Search Optimized)

1. Does the Deco X20 replace my router?

✅ Yes! It works as a standalone mesh system—just plug it into your modem.

2. Can I use Ethernet backhaul?

✅ Yes! All 3 units have 2 Ethernet ports each for wired connections.

3. Is WiFi 6 worth it?

✅ Absolutely! Faster speeds, better efficiency, and supports 150+ devices.

4. Does it work with Xfinity/AT&T?

✅ Yes! Compatible with all ISPs (modem required).
